Hilarious facts about michigan. Fun Facts About Michigan. Michigan is the only place in the world with a floating post office. Westcott II is the only boat in the world that delivers mail to ships while they are still underway.
They have been operating for 125 years. More tonnage passes though the historic Soo Locks in Sault Ste. Marie than the Suez and Panama Canals combined.

There are no longer any living wolverines in the Wolverine State. There was one discovered in Huron County in 2004 the first one spotted in 200 years but it has since passed on and has now been stuffed and mounted. Here are 40 Interesting Michigan facts. 1-5 Michigan Facts 1. Michigan has a bottle deposit of 10 cents instead of the usual 5 cents.

Michigan lies in the Great Lakes and Midwestern regions of the US and attained its statehood back on the 26 th of January 1837 becoming the 26 th state to do so. Michigan was colonized by the French in the 17th century. The name possibly comes from the French version of the Ojibwe word meshi-gami which means big lake.

Detroit is known as the car capital of the world. Alpena is the home of the worlds largest cement plant. Rogers City boasts the worlds largest limestone quarry.
Elsie is the home of the worlds largest registered Holstein dairy herd. Michigan is first in the United States production of peat and magnesium. Interesting facts about Lake Michigan.
